CCPA Privacy Rights (Do Not Sell My Personal Information)

Under CCPA, among other rights, California consumers have the right to:

  • Require any business collecting a consumer’s personal information to disclose the categories and specific pieces of personal information a business has collected about consumers.
  • Require any business to delete any personal information about the consumer that a business has collected.
  • Require any business that sells a consumer’s personal information not sell the consumer’s personal information.

GDPR Data Protection Rights

We intend to fully communicate your data protection rights. Each user has the right to:

  • The right of access – You are entitled to ask for copies of your personal data. We are allowed to charge a small fee for that service.
  • The right to rectification – You have the right to request that we correct any information you believe is inaccurate. You also have the right to request that we complete any information you believe is incomplete.
  • The right to erasure – You have the right to request that we erase your personal data, under certain conditions.
  • The right to restrict processing – You have the right to request that we restrict the processing of your personal data, under certain conditions.
  • The right to object to processing – You have the right to object to our processing of your personal data, under certain conditions.
  • The right to data portability – You have the right to request us to transfer data that we have gathered to another organization, or directly to you, under certain conditions.
